Ok I just talked with SFX's programmer. Unichip will test a base car and get a MAP established. Then they will go find modded cars and pay them (or get employees cars) to dyno and tune. For every tune they create a new map and setup a database for that car. For the MSP, they got a stock MSP, then they slapped a CAI on it and tuned again. Then they got someone with an exhaust AND intake and tuned that. So the end-programmer has a few dropdowns and my programmer told me he selected all of them. Exhaust, CAI, and could factor in the cooler air temps from an intercooler.... but the exhaust and CAI make the biggest change, I think the intercooler is a more general offset but doesnt change things much. For more popular cars, Unichip will have tuned all sorts of types with all sorts of mods. There are about 4-5 options as of now for the MSP. I think if I were to get mine custom tuned @ unichip... there might be a FMIC map created and sent to Unichips main database.... but don't quote me on that. I think that if they get good results and test a couple of cars it gets added.

Ok, wow chill out. Yes, this is a good price but guess what it wont last for long. They are violating Unichips MAP(minimum advertised price) price requirement. They will get cut off by their supplier one way or another. Manufacturers use third party companies to enforce their pricing policies like www.netenforcers.com. Also, really do you trust getting tech support from a company that doesn't even have experience with a Protege for something such as engine tuning? Whoring out products is a common occurance by small new companies starting up to attract customers. While a good business strategy it hurts the product market value. Manufacturers are all adopting MAP policies. If a vendor violates that policy, they can be sued if they continue to use their images or products on their site for infringing intellectual property rights and be cut off once they find out who their supplier is.
